Holi Crackdown: Pune Traffic Police Take Action Against 402 Drunk Drivers

Pune, 15th March 2025: In a concerted effort to maintain safety and order during Holi celebrations, the Pune Police Traffic Branch conducted a special drive across the city. As part of this initiative, 8,552 vehicles were inspected, resulting in action against 402 drivers for drunk driving.
The operation involved setting up checkpoints at 90 locations to curb reckless driving. According to Deputy Commissioner of Police (Traffic) Amol Zende, the campaign was conducted under the guidance of Pune City Commissioner of Police Amitesh Kumar and other senior officials. As a result, 386 vehicles were seized for various traffic violations, including triple riding, wrong-side driving, and drunk driving.
A total of 6,118 cases were registered, including 402 for drunk driving, 921 for triple-seat riding, and 852 for wrong-side driving, with fines amounting to ₹50,94,000. The police emphasized the importance of traffic discipline in preventing accidents and ensuring a safe and enjoyable festival for all citizens.
